Hacker group OurMine hacks into Sony Music’s Twitter account


In a yet another high-profile Twitter account compromise this year, the hacker group OurMine broke into Sony Music’s Twitter account, flashing a news that famous singer Britney Spears "is dead by accident".

"Britney Spears is dead by accident! We will tell you more soon #RIPBrtiney," the tweet from OurMine read late on Monday. As soon as this was tweeted, Sony Music immediately swung into action and tweeted after recovering their handle @SonyMusicGlobal: "We saw a new IP logged in to the account a few minutes ago and the tweet is posted by a new IP so @britneyspears is still alive #OurMine."

Both these tweets have now been removed from Sony Music Global’s account.


Spears' manager Adam Leber was quoted by CNN as saying that the pop star was alive, officially debunking the rumour.

OurMine has previously hacked into some high-profile Twitter handles in the past, including those of Facebook CEO Mark Zuckerberg, Twitter CEO Jack Dorsey, Niantic head John Hanke and Evan Williams, the co-founder and former CEO of Twitter.

OurMine also hacked into BuzzFeed’s website in October and accessed Twitter accounts of Netflix and Marvel.

"We don’t know who is our next target," OurMine had told CNET in an email last week.

OurMine hacked BuzzFeed News, defaced multiple articles; accuses them of publishing "fake" news


BuzzFeed News, Buzzfeed's news site had reportedly been breached by hacker group OurMine. The hackers "vandalized" many of BuzzfeedNews' reports and left messages stating, "Hacked by OurMine team, don’t share fake news about us again, we have your database. Next time it will be public. Don’t f[***] with OurMine again."

The hack was in retaliation to a BuzzFeed story(mirrored here) that exposed an alleged member of OurMine. OurMine denied any connection to the alleged member of the group and seem to have protested by, of all things, hacking BuzzFeed News.


BuzzFeed tried to take down the affected posts "within minutes" and that BuzzFeed was working to restore all stories in their original form.

OurMine's reference to a database might seem menacing, but there's no indication from OurMine or BuzzFeed as to what that database contains.

Lately, OurMine has been making a name for itself by going around hacking Twitter accounts of prominent celebrities, including those of Mark Zuckerberg, Sundar Pichai, and Jack Dorsey.
